Prof. Boni - Innovation in surgery. NIR - ICG in partial white light and hybrid energy

During the last few years several new technologies have been introduced in the clinical practices allowing surgeons to perform more precise surgeries and to reduce post-operative complication.
The aim of this practical course is to demonstrate during live surgical procedures and lectures the potentials and the application of different new technologies with special interest in the
field of energy devices and fluorescence guided surgery, thanks to the partecipations of leading national and international faculty The course is open to consultants, residents, anesthetists and scrub nurses.

9:00 Introduction
Live surgery
- OR 1:
- Laparoscopic cholecystectomy with fluorescent cholangiography.
- Laparoscopic sigmoid resection for colovesical fistula due to complicated diverticular disease with fluorescent identification of the ureter and fluorescent angiography.
OR 2:
- Laparoscopic d2 distal gastrectomy with fluorescent lymphatic mapping.
- Laparoscopic right colectomy with fluorescent lymphatic mapping.
